Celebrating Diversity, Creativity In African Fashion Through AMVCA Cultural Day

The Africa Magic Viewers’ Choice Awards (AMVCA) held its ninth edition on Thursday, May 18, 2023, with a vibrant ‘Opening Night and Cultural Day’ event.

The event was a celebration of the rich tapestry of African culture and diversity, and the attendees including celebrities truly showcased their impeccable fashion choices, leaving no stone unturned.

The cultural event showcased the epitome of African fashion, delighting the senses with a dazzling display of creativity and style.

Alongside the mesmerizing attire, the occasion embraced the richness of African culture through captivating displays of art, music, and dance. The audience witnessed breathtaking performances by skilled traditional drummers, soulful singers, and graceful dancers.

Additionally, a spoken word artist graced the stage, delivering a powerful poetry reading that resonated with the hearts of all attendees. The event truly embodied the dashing spirit and creativity of African traditions.

The AMVCA Cultural Day proved to be an unforgettable and remarkable occasion, showcasing the richness and diversity of African culture and heritage. It was an evening filled with pride and moments that will linger in our memories for a long time to come.

The highlight of the event was the outfits donned by the celebrities. From traditional Nigerian attire to modern interpretations of African prints, there was something for everyone to admire.
